What are your website designs written in?

All of my website designs are written entirely in XHTML 1.0 and CSS. No tables are used for the layout or styling in any of the website designs. This combination of XHTML and CSS ensures that the websites are forward compatible, quick loading and easily customisable. Relative font sizes have been used to help aid accessibility and all of the designs can be validated as XHTML 1.0 Strict or Transitional, and CSS.
